Huggies Delivers Brand Message Every Time A Baby Pees

huggies_tweetpee.jpg

This is most definitely a first. Huggies, with help from Ogilvy Brasil, has released Tweet Pee, a mobile app and sensor that will determine when your bay’s diaper is wet, notify you and tweet about it. Now if that isn’t worse than all those “I just ate a donut for breakfast” tweets, I don’t know what is. Do we really need to know when a baby pees?

On the useful side, the app keeps track of how many diapers the baby has gone through and alerts the paranet when it’s time to head to the store for more Huggies. In that respect, it ‘s a wonderful way to keep the parent connected to the brand. Via.
